In this guided decluttering episode, we tackle one of the most avoided office categories: charging cords and old tech.

Cords tend to pile up not because we need them — but because we're afraid of being irresponsible if we let them go. Today, we break that belief and walk step by step through how to deal with cords in a calm, practical way.

Amber Cammidge hosts Declutter Your Chaos-Mindful Minimalism, a podcast that approaches the overwhelming task of clearing out your space with a unique blend of practicality and introspection. This isn't just about where to donate old clothes or how to fold a fitted sheet, though you'll find those tangible tips here. Instead, each conversation digs into the emotional roots of accumulation, exploring how our habits around stuff are often tied to memory, identity, or a sense of scarcity. The aim is to move beyond a one-time cleanup and foster a lasting, mindful minimalism that creates mental and physical room to breathe. You'll hear about resetting daily routines, building systems that actually work for your real life, and redefining what 'enough' truly means. Grounded in categories like self-improvement and mental health, this podcast recognizes that a calmer home directly supports a fitter, healthier, and more educated self. It's for anyone feeling weighed down by their possessions and ready to explore the quieter, more intentional life that exists just beneath the surface of the clutter. Tune in for honest talks that help you transform your environment from a source of chaos into a foundation for the life you're trying to build.
